Understanding IELTS and Its Importance
The IELTS exam includes 4 modules: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king, and the results exist in a band rating format ranging from 0 to 9. Each band score represents a level of English efficiency, with 9 being the greatest. The significance of IELTS results extends beyond mere scholastic examination; they play an important function in visa applications, job positionings, and university admissions both in your area and internationally.

1. How long are IELTS scores valid?
IELTS scores are normally valid for two years from the test date.
2. Can I ask for a re-evaluation of my IELTS ratings?
Yes, candidates can look for an Enquiry on Results (EOR) if they think their scores do not show their performance. This process incurs an additional fee.

The passing score differs based on the university or immigration requirements. The majority of universities require a band rating of 6.0 to 7.5.
2. Are there any IELTS test centers in Pakistan?
Yes, there are numerous IELTS test focuses situated in significant cities such as Karachi, Lahore, Islamabad, and Peshawar.
3. What are the fees for taking the IELTS in Pakistan?
Since the current info, the IELTS fee in Pakistan is approximately PKR 29,000 - 31,000, however it’s advisable to talk to the private test centers for the most precise prices.
4. What is the Speaking test format?
The Speaking test is an in person interview with a qualified examiner, lasting 11-14 minutes, and is divided into 3 parts: introduction, a longer private speaking opportunity, and a two-way discussion.
